Taylor Wessing acts for Eidos in acquisition of IO Interactive
Taylor Wessing acts for Eidos on a conditional agreement to acquire the entire share capital of IO, a leading European video game software developer based in Denmark.
The initial consideration payable is £23 million and will be satisfied by £21 million in cash and 1.5 million new Eidos shares, subject to certain lock-up provisions. Deferred consideration of up to £5 million in cash is payable dependent upon the number of new game units released in excess of 2.1 million units per annum over the four year period following completion.
